Welcome to MSDN Blogs Sign in | Join | Help

El pasado 27 de Octubre dio inicio la conferencia dedicada a desarrolladores más importante para Microsoft, el Profesional Developer Conference 2008, en la ciudad de Los Angeles, California. Si bien durante el evento se realizaron varios anuncios que develan la nueva tecnología que podremos consumir los próximos meses, tales como Windows 7, Silverligt 2.0, Windows Server 2008 R2, el que me considero de mayor relevancia para la habilitación de soluciones bajo la estrategia de Software + Servicios es lo anunciado como Windows Azure

clip_image001

Esta tecnología esta compuesta por varios servicios disponibles en los centros de datos de Microsoft. Si bien todo el detalle lo puedes encontrar en www.microsoft.com/azure me gustaría comentar varios puntos:

  • Los componentes Live Services, .Net Services, SQL Services, SharePoint Services y Dynamics CRM Services, son un conjunto de Servicios que nos permiten desarrollar Bloques Aplicativos que podrán ser consumidos por nuevos desarrollos basados en SOA, permitiendo tener una gran capacidad de computo escalable y de alto desempeño.
  • Los componentes de Windows Azure son a los que se les ha llamado el Sistema Operativo en la Nube, ya se cuenta con servicios de Computo, Almacenamiento y Administración que pueden ser utilizados por aplicaciones desarrolladas con Azure Services o con solo .Net - lo que se llamaría de forma "tradicional" hasta hoy.

clip_image002

Todas las sesiones del PDC se encuentran grabadas y disponibles en el sitio www.microsoftpdc.com

Saludos.

¿Has escuchado acerca de Microsoft Developer Conference (PDC) que se llevará a cabo en Octubre? PDC es una gran oportunidad para obtener una perspectiva completa del futuro en las tecnologías Microsoft con la posibilidad de acceder a nuevos recursos y estar en contacto con ingenieros de Microsoft y con personas que realizan actividades similares a las tuyas y de tus equipos de trabajo.
Durante el PDC 2008, podras enterarse de lo nuevo en Cloud Services, Live Mesh, Windows 7®, multi-core development, the Dynamic Language Runtime, F# y mucho más.

Algunos puntos adicionales sobre el PDC 2008:

clip_image002PDC 2008 es el lugar para escuchar sobre el futuro de la plataforma Microsoft de primera mano, ya que los ponentes serán los ingenieros actuales que desarrollan la arquitectura y construyen las  tecnologías de Microsoft.

clip_image002¿Qué opinas de las UnSessions, mejor conocidas como Open Space? Es una conferencia dentro de otra conferencia para los asistentes. incluso los que trabajan en Microsoft deben aplicar para asistir a esta actividad. También podras ingresar a los talleres sobre las tecnologías futuras de Microsoft.

clip_image002No te pierdas las sesiones previas al evento, donde podras interactuar con expertos en la industria y líderes tecnológicos de Microsoft aprovechando asi el conocimiento adquirido y aplicarlo en las actividades que ejecutas día a día.

clip_image002Escucha a Ray Ozzie, Don Box, Chris Anderson y otros ejecutivos (ellos escribían código también) compartir sus perspectivas sobre el futuro de la tecnología y del computo.clip_image003

Desde que fue anunciada esta visión y estrategia de Microsoft, se ha debatido en diferentes foros si la opción de tener datos, autentificación, reglas/flujos de negocio y/o capacidades de computo en la nube, es una alternativa real y viable para la empresa en general y para el mercado mexicano en particular.

Lo que es indudable es que estas nuevas opciones permiten tener acceso a tecnologías complejas de instalar, soportar y escalar, son ya una realidad y representan una alternativa real de agilidad, facilidad y escalabilidad para soluciones innovadoras que no necesariamente son de misión critica, pero que representan nuevos canales de difusión y captación de nuevos clientes . El que no sean misión critica no implica que no tengan un impacto sustantivo en el negocio, solo significa que el que dejen de operar no impactara en una vida humana o en una pérdida irreparable, esto principalmente debido que al ser servicios aplicativos hosteados con un proveedor de servicio de IT sujeto a un SLA (Service Level Agreement) irremediablemente tendrá que tener ventas de tiempo para el soporte de la infraestructura y en ocasiones, como ya le ha pasado inclusa a Google's Gmail, Amazon's S3, y salesforce.com, interrupciones no planeadas por problemas de energía o fallas en los centros de datos no necesariamente ligados la infraestructura de computo.

Es mi opinión que en un corto plazo, y con todas las iniciativas de Green IT, estos problemas sean cada vez menos frecuentes y nos tendremos que avocar a otro tipo de problemas, en mi perspectiva de índole político, como serán los relacionados a la privacidad de información, el tener un respaldo legal de los niveles de servicio cuantificados en montos de compensación por fallas en los servicios contratados y la propiedad intelectual y de uso de la información que este almacenada en la infraestructura del hoster.

Lo que yo considero crítico es conocer y asegurarse de entender el nivel de confidencialidad y seguridad a la que este sujeto el proveedor de servicios en escenarios que requieran que datos sensitivos para una organización residan fuera del entorno contralado por el personal de confianza. Un escenario típico se ilustra en la siguiente imagen:

image

Esto ilustra como una empresa tiene el poder de decisión de en donde y en qué nivel de confidencialidad decide utilizar los servicios de Exchange, ya sea totalmente dentro de su control, de un Proveedor de Servicios en un esquema compartido, o de Microsoft en esquema de servicios distribuidos y dedicado.

Cada uno de los escenarios tiene sus ventajas y desventajas que deberán ser evaluadas de acuerdo a las necesidades particulares de cada organización.

En un escenario de desarrollo de aplicaciones vemos algo como lo que se ilustra en la siguiente imagen:

image

Como se muestra la figura, hacer los servicios de integración aplicativa basados en Internet permite conectar aplicaciones que viven tanto en la misma empresa como entre diferentes empresas. Dentro de la infraestructura donde las aplicaciones son ejecutas (Enterprise), BizTalk Services ofrece un motor de flujo de trabajo para ejecutar la lógica empresarial para controlar el proceso de integración.

Estos escenarios de soluciones, que ya están listos para ser usados, muestran el valor del Poder de Decisión que se tiene al adoptar la estrategia de Software + Servicios en escenarios innovadores con gran Agilidad.

Agradezco lo comentarios y obervaciones que puedan compartir en este Blog.

Esta es una pregunta que he recibido por varios de ustedes, la respuesta no me es fácil.

El Foro Empresarial de Arquitectos ha sido una estrategia que, como Arquitecto de Soluciones y como promotor dentro de Microsoft del valor e importancia de contar en todo proyecto de las capacidades que un Arquitecto de Software, Infraestructura, Datos, Integración, etc., indiscutiblemente ha traído gran valor para las organizaciones y carrera de quienes han participado asintiendo y contribuyendo con su experiencia y conocimiento.

Es indudable que la industria de TI esta cambiando de forma acelerada, que cada vez existen más y más opciones tecnológicas para resolver problema cotidianos y que resulta muy demandante estar al día en todas y cada una de estas tecnologías para poder obtener el beneficio que pueda brindar a nuestra organización, y como Arquitectos debemos adquirir o incrementar nuestras capacidades de administración de tecnología, si es que no hemos tenido oportunidad de incursionar en esto temas, y es de mi interés contribuir en el desarrollo de este conocimiento, tanto desde el punto de vista de Microsoft como de lideres en la industria, lo cual trae consigo retos de logística y prioridades en el armado de contenido, frecuencia y nivel de profundidad al incluir estos temas dentro de una agenda ligada a retos y visiones de tecnología y Arquitectura de TI.

Dado este escenario el Foro esta siendo re-estructurado para dar cabida a estos nuevos retos.

Se creará un nuevo espacio para compartir experiencias y conocimiento de temas relacionados con la administración de la tecnología. Esta iniciativa podrá ser seguida en el sitio: http://blogs.technet.com/itmanager/default.aspx

Los temas tecnológicos y puramente de Arquitectura de TI serán presentados en formas no presenciales, con mayor frecuencia, serán grabadas y accesibles en cualquier momento, permitiendo así tener un mayor alcance y re-uso.

El Foro Regional de Arquitectos 2009 no será la excepción en estos cambios, todavía no esta al 100% la estrategia en este evento, estén pendientes de lo que será el nuevo formato.

Me gustaría escuchar que opinan de estos cambios y que esperarían por parte del equipo de Arquitectura de Microsoft para seguir contribuyendo con su desarrollo profesional y el de sus organizaciones.

Una de las principales iniciativas, para desarrollar soluciones empresariales, que Microsoft viene desarrollando desde hace más de 5 años es sin duda la de Enterprise Library. El pasado mes de Mayo fue liberada la versión 4.0 después de pasar varias etapas de revisión por la comunidad.

El Enterprise Library 4.0 incluye, entre otras cosas:

· Soporte e Integración con Visual Studio 2008,

· Adecuaciónes y mejoras en los bloques aplicativos de "Validation" y "Policy Injection",

· Mayor extensibilidad en el bloque de "Caching",

· Mejoras en desempeño en el bloque de Logging,

· Soporte más simple para "Partial Trust"

Todo el detalle de los Bloques Aplicativos que lo componen lo puedes obtener en el sitio patterns & practices - Enterprise Library - Home, así como toda la información de referencia de la comunidad que ha estado llevando a cabo la revisión y mejora en http://www.codeplex.com/entlib, en donde también se incluyen recursos para entender a profundidad y mitigar la curva de aprendizaje.

 

Espero que te sea de utilidad.

Recientemente se ejecuto una serie de webcast de Introducción a la Arquitectura de Software organizado por el equipo de Arquitectura de Microsoft Latino América. Te invito a que los revises y opines que te parecieron.

Conferencia Online Arquitectura 101click aquí.

Metodologías y Ciclo de Vida del Desarrollo de Software, click aquí.

Arquitectura Orientada a Servicios. click aquí.

La Transición al Rol de Arquitecto de Software, click aquí.

 

Ya estamos planeado la siguiente serie. ¿Te gustaría participar? Mándame un correo para incluirte en la lista de invitados.

¿Qué temas te gustaría que fueran presentados? Me interesa saber cómo contribuir a que te posiciones mejor dentro de tu organización como Arquitecto y me parece que esta es una oportunidad para lograrlo.

 

Hasta pronto.

Los invito a ver la memoria digital grabada por QuiteLoudFM del Foro Regional de Arquitectos México 2008.

¿Qué temas o actividades deberían ser incluidas en los eventos que organiza Microsoft para los Arquitectos de IT?

Microsoft RAF 2008 QuiteLoudFM ::

Quiero compartirles este sitio en donde podrán ver la visión complete de Microsoft en el tema de Software + Servicios, me parece una excelente fuente para que, ya sea que pertenezcas a una empresa privada, pública o a un desarrollador o integrador de soluciones TI, obtengas benéficos de reducción de TCO, productividad, nuevos canales de generación de demanda y nuevos modelos de negocio solo por mencionar los principales.

Software Plus Services : Bring It All Together

Quiero agradecer a todos los que asistieron a este evento. Las presentaciones serán cargadas al sitio global del evento www.microsoft.com/mexico/raf2008, pero mientras esto sucede, me permito compartirles un folde en mi espacio de skydrive para que puedan tener acceso a ellas.

En breve les compartiré la memoria digital del evento, así como los cometarios que nos permitirán hacer de este evento un espacio de transformación tecnológica de México.

 

Saludos.

Microsoft México - Foro Regional de Arquitectos 2008

image

image

Tengo el gusto de invitarte a la 4ª edición del Foro Regional de Arquitectos - RAF.

El RAF es el evento cumbre de la Comunidad Empresarial de Arquitectos en este año y reunirá a 150 arquitectos estratégicos y líderes tecnológicos clave de diversas instituciones y empresas mexicanas.
El RAF será un evento de alto nivel, en el que los arquitectos compartirán su visión y discutirán sus necesidades de negocio con líderes tecnológicos quienes presentarán temas relevantes de la industria y la forma como estos afectan a nuestras organizaciones.

Este evento será además una gran oportunidad para interactuar con colegas de otras organizaciones y para involucrarse en una discusión relevante que estamos seguros impactará positivamente las decisiones tecnológicas que su negocio requiere.

image

Datos del evento:

Lugar: Hotel Sheraton Centro Histórico.

Dirección: Av. Juarez #70 Col. Centro, México DF.

 clip_image004
image
image

He recibido varias peticiones sobre las ppts de las presentaciones de la pasada edición del Foro de Arquitectos Microsoft, y les informo que ya están disponibles en nuestro sitio en la sección de Foros (http://www.microsoft.com/mexico/arquitectura/foros.aspx). Adicional a esto también ya están disponibles las grabaciones de las sesiones, tanto para que las vean en línea como para descargarlas.

Puedes acceder desde el link https://www.livemeeting.com/cc/microsoft/view y con recording Id y Key de Cada uno o dando click en la link directo.

Titulo

Link Directo

Claves de Acceso

Foro Febrero GDL PET

View Recording

Recording ID: BZR267
Attendee Key: 9n6;P4<RR

Foro Febrero GDL IT Governance

View Recording

Recording ID: 8TG84T
Attendee Key: 9n6;P4<RR

Foro Febrero MTY PET

View Recording

Recording ID: 8NJR75
Attendee Key: 9n6;P4<RR

Foro Febrero MTY IP TV

View Recording

Recording ID: GJCSM8
Attendee Key: 9n6;P4<RR

Foro Febrero MTY IT Governance

View Recording

Recording ID: 7Q7DQG
Attendee Key: 9n6;P4<RR

 

Por favor indíquenme si tuvieran algún problema para ver esta información.

En las visitas y conversaciones que tengo con arquitectos de soluciones, constantemente recibo peticiones de cómo profundizar y estar al tanto de la posición y la visión de Microsoft en temas como SOA,  Preparación para la Certificación como Arquitectos, .Net 3.5, etc. Por lo que quiero utilizar este espacio para poner a su disposición algunos recursos que considero pueden ayudarles a cubrir este tipo de necesidades de información, posiblemente algunos de ellos ustedes ya los conozcan y me gustaría saber sus comentarios al respecto.

SOA Workshop for Architects Series: Serie de Wecasts orientados a Arquitectos donde se abordan diversos temas de SOA: http://www.microsoft.com/biztalk/solutions/soa/webcasts.mspx

Información de primera mano sobre la visión y estrategia de Microsoft en el tema de SOA, el hoy y el mañana: http://www.microsoft.com/soa/

Serie de WebCasts para Arquitectos en Español: Parte de las iniciativas del grupo de Arquitectura de Microsoft Latam organizados por la Comunidad de Arquitectura de Mexico y el Grupo de Arquitectura de Microsoft Latino América. Puedes ver la grabación de la sesión anterior en: https://msevents.microsoft.com/CUI/WebCastRegistrationConfirmation.aspx?culture=es-AR&RegistrationID=1295185232&Validate=false

Definitivamente el tema de Experiencia de Usuario ha puesto en duda algunos paradigmas en el uso de aplicaciones ricas a través de Internet sobre un browser. Les recomiendo el White Paper de David Chapel en donde describe el uso de Windows Presentation Fundation (WPF) y aclara la diferencia en el uso de WPF vs Silverligth.

Ya por último, y muy de la mano a al tema anterior, les recomiendo revisen todo lo relacionado a Software Factories, en especial el de Smart Client y de Web Services, les pueden ayudar a agilizar sus futuros desarrollos, así como este recurso http://blogs.msdn.com/gblock/archive/2008/02/25/get-trained-on-web-client-software-factory-2-0.aspx para conocer más del Software Factorie de Web Client.

 

¿Qué opinan?

Te recomiendo el blog "Rob Tiffany's Windows Mobile Accelerator", en donde claramente se puede apreciar que no siempre "más es más" y en donde se explica los pasos a seguir para afinar una aplicación que tenga alto desempeño y alta escalabilidad. Así como la capacidad que tiene la plataforma Microsoft para alto volumen de usuarios concurrentes en una solución Mobile.

 

Saludos.

Muchos se preguntaran si esto es cierto, debo admitir que a mí me causo sorpresa esta noticia, y aunque habrá quienes opinen que no es tan “abierto”, ustedes juzguen los siguientes hechos:

·         El pasado 3 de Octubre Microsoft dio un paso muy importante en este aspecto al publicar, bajo el acuerdo de Licenciamiento de Referencia (http://www.microsoft.com/resources/sharedsource/licensingbasics/referencelicense.mspx), el código fuente del framework .Net 3.0 para poder ser visto incluyendo cometarios, y aunque no puede ser copiado o re-compilado, permite llevar a cabo debuging (revisa este post -http://weblogs.asp.net/scottgu/archive/2007/10/03/releasing-the-source-code-for-the-net-framework-libraries.aspx - para más información de cómo hacerlo) e incluso puedes reportar las fallas que encuentres en el código en este sitio: http://connect.microsoft.com/feedback/default.aspx?SiteID=210

 

·         En noviembre fue lanzado el sitio Open Source at Microsoft en el cual podrás encontrar toda la información relacionada a la participación de Microsoft en el mundo de OSS, conocer cuál es la visión y compromiso para con la comunidad de OSS, así como links a sitios como Codeplex, Sharesource y Port25, que son los principales sitios en donde encontraras los recursos necesarios para participar en esta nueva iniciativa de Microsoft en reconocimiento del valor que el Código Abierto tiene para el desarrollo de soluciones nuevas e innovadoras.

 

¿Qué opinas?

More Posts Next page »
 
Page view tracker